The Influence of Contingency Factors on the Adoption of Information Systems: The case of Moroccan companies

Abstract

The aim of this study is to analyze the impact of structural contingency factors on the adoption of information systems, taking into account their nature and degree of complexity, as well as to assess the influence of the Covid-19 crisis on this adoption. To achieve this objective, we undertook quantitative research by interviewing a sample of 43 companies. Data were collected by means of a questionnaire, and analysis was carried out using SPSS software. The results highlight the significant influence of structural contingency factors and the Covid-19 crisis on the adoption of information systems.
